Acid rain is a complex, worldwide environmental problem. This study guide is intended to aid teachers of grades 4-12 to help their students understand what acid rain is, why it is a problem, and what possible solutions exist. Stead, Keith – 1982
This research sought to identify reasons why the study of science was being rejected by girls and Polynesian students.
